Question Mercury 9.8 carb float setting

Would appreciate any info on setting the float level on my 1974 mercury 9.8 model 110, carb # 4898A1. Its been sitting up for a few yrs an hate to admit it but i left it w/ fuel still in carb.I know I'll have to clean it up but wanted to ck float setting while I'm there.Thanks, all replies welcome

Default Re: Mercury 9.8 carb float setting

Just a update to earlier post : Dissasembled to carb except for the throttle & choke shafts, which actually looked clean except for a little trash at the f.p.screen.Sprayed it down with carb cleaner & put her back together.After a warm up & adjustment she's running as well as ever.
